Hosted by Swiss perfumer Andy Tauer, the podcast explores the art and craft of niche perfumery. Through personal reflections, he talks about scent, creativity and memory, and about the encounters and emotions that shape how we smell the world. Episodes also look behind the scenes of the perfume industry and the life of an independent artist and entrepreneur. The show is an intimate, conversational take on an invisible craft and the space we share through scent.

    The Price of EasyWhy do so many modern perfumes feel different, yet somehow strangely similar?In this episode, I look at how perfumery arrived here. Synthetic molecules such as Ambroxan and Iso E Super transformed perfumery — and I use them myself and love them. They are powerful, stable, reliable and wonderful to work with. But mass production, globalization, cost, availability and regulation have gradually pushed much of the industry toward the same highly efficient solutions.Naturals are different. Rose, jasmine, cistus, labdanum and other materials can be expensive, variable, difficult and sometimes frustrating. But they also bring friction, complexity and surprise.I talk about why my own perfumes use both worlds — Ambroxan and cistus, Iso E and jasmine absolute, synthetics and large amounts of naturals — and why that matters.If modern perfumery sometimes feels too polished or predictable, there are two ways out: look backwards to the treasures of the past, or look sidewards toward independent perfumers who can still afford to make things differently.
